Carole J. (Harosky) Sitch, age 67, of Evansville, Ind., passed away on Saturday, February 27, 2010, at her home.

Carole Jean was born and raised in Ford City, Pennsylvania, where she met her husband Chuck. She was a wonderful wife and Mother who generously gave of her heart to others....
